Asian Development Bank downgrades China's inflation to 3.2% in 2010
The Asian Development Bank downgraded its forecast for China's consumer price index (CPI) from 3.6% to 3.2% for 2010, due to the postponing of price increases for water, natural gas and electricity from this year to next year (Shanghai Securities News, 29-Sep-2010). China's CPI rose to a 22-month high of 3.5% in Aug-2010. The bank maintains its forecast of China's GDP growth of 9.6% in 2010 and 9.1% in 2011.
